After August 1998, we took a general
investigation within a
340-kilometer-square area in Taihang
Mountain. It continued nearly 3 years
and inluded dozens of routes.
It is nearly 9 years. We have known many details
about these big cats. We have videos for
9 big cats and photos for 10 big cats.

Since wild feline are very aggressive, the study
of feline is really highlighted. Even
though, we still know only a little
about them, espeically in China. We have
only a few sources to learn this
knowledge, such as zoos and shelters.
Observations directly from the nature is
too few. Because of their beauty, many
people enjoy hunting them, as a result,
they have struggled in a suffering life
since long long ago. The feline
population has decayed rapidly; and some
of them are extinct or in critical risk
situation. In some cases, they are
extinct before people know them. It is a
tragedy for the earth, for human beings.
Shanxi province is one of the provinces that have
the most species and biggest population
of feline in China. Many species of
feline has been recored in history by
civilian, such as North-China-Tiger
(popular name: Yellow leopard, or yellow
stick), leopard, leopard cat,
Chinese-Zongwen-Tiger (Ai-ye leopard),
Horse-Tiger (donkey-head animal),
Stone-Tiger (Tu leopard), lynx etc. How
about them now? How are they living? How
can we protect them? That is our task.
